UV protection plays a vital role in preserving your balayage. When spending time outdoors, wear a hat or use hair products with UV filters to shield your color from sun damage. Swimming requires special attention - wet your hair with clean water before entering pools, and use a swim cap when possible to prevent chlorine from affecting your colo

To prevent color fading and maintain your balayage's vibrancy, you'll need to adjust your hair care routine immediately after your salon visit. Wait at least 48 hours before washing your hair, allowing the color to fully set. Many experts recommend using web page to protect your investment. When you do wash, use lukewarm water instead of hot water, as high temperatures can open the hair cuticle and cause color molecules to escape. Always use color-safe, sulfate-free shampoo and conditioner specifically formulated for color-treated hai
